Located at the Paya Lebar Airbase, the place is open to the public daily except for public holidays. The place has a display of the outdated fighter/bomber and helicopters from the 1960s to the 1990s.
There is a fighter simulator and a interesting exhibition on the 2nd level. A good place to bring kids for some national education. It is free of charge and the personnel in-charge are very helpful and friendly. Lots of space for kids to run around and explore.
